With the ballet “Carmen” has closed the summer activities of the Grand Theatre of Pompeii which with two dates in September proposed a preview of what will be the “Pompeii festival“, by June 2015, pending a signed project by architect Paolo Portoghesi (as part of the agreement between the Superintendent and the Association of Development of the Sicilian Symphonic by maestro Alberto Veronesi), which will also include an amphitheater with a capacity of 20 thousand seats. The organization did not have a hitch for the performance of “Ballet of the South” which brought to an audience closer to the “sold out” show the run-Carmen (over 100 performances), two acts with choreography by Fredy Franzutti to music by Bizet, Chabrier, Massenet and Albeniz. Applause for Chiara Mazzola (Carmen), Francesco Cafforio (Jose), Alessandro De Ceglia (the bullfighter Escamillo), Vittoria Pellegrino (Micaela) and Angelo Egarese (Zuniga).
